Postby Admin » Tue Dec 18, 2007 8:03 pm

Hello ukman,

This forum is lightly moderated and this is no secret. Some like it that way, some don't. It is not possible to keep everybody satisfied. Those that do not like it should simply stop to visit without making a fuss about it.

Complaints and suggestions received by members are always seriously considered. When your complaint involves another member I first evaluate the situation and then usually send a warning to the member in question. Apart from the spammers and those who are intentionally trying to harm the forum I rarely ban a member without first discussing the issue with them and trying to resolve it in a different way.

Please send any further complaints you might have via a private message as per our rules.

Thank you.
